What Exactly Is a Real-Money Casino and How Does It Work?

A real-money casino is an online platform where you deposit your own funds to play games of chance or skill, with the direct possibility of withdrawing any winnings. The system works through a digital wallet: you fund your account via credit card, e-wallet, or crypto, and the balance is converted into “chips” for the game. Each game operates on a random number generator (RNG) to ensure outcomes are unpredictable and fair. When you win, your balance increases in real-time. To cash out, you request a withdrawal, which the casino validates before sending your money back. Always verify a game’s RTP before playing your first hand or spin. The Role of Random Number Generators in Fair Play

At the heart of every legitimate real-money casino game is a Random Number Generator (RNG), a tiny algorithm that constantly spits out unpredictable results. This ensures every spin, card dealt, or dice roll is entirely independent of the last—no patterns, no memory. The RNG guarantees that your win or loss is purely chance, not influenced by the casino or other players. So when you hit the jackpot or lose a hand, it’s the algorithm doing its job, keeping the game fair for everyone at the table. You can trust that each outcome is just as random as the one before.

Choosing the Right Payment Method for Deposits and Withdrawals

Select a payment method that balances speed, cost, and security for your specific region. E-wallets like Skrill or Neteller typically offer the fastest withdrawals, often processing within 24 hours, while credit cards provide solid deposit reliability but may incur bank fees or longer settlement times for cash-outs. C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in eliminate intermediary delays but require careful address verification to avoid transaction errors. Always confirm the casino’s minimum and maximum limits align with your bankroll, and prioritize methods that do not charge extra processing fees for either direction. Testing with a small deposit first validates the full cycle from funding to payout.

Understanding Welcome Bonuses and Their Wagering Requirements

Welcome bonuses are a great way to boost your starting bankroll, but the real key is understanding the playthrough conditions attached. These wagering requirements tell you how many times you must bet the bonus (and often the deposit) before you can withdraw any winnings. Always check the fine print before claiming. For example, a 100% match with a 35x requirement means you need to wager your bonus amount 35 times over.

  • Low wagering requirements (under 30x) are generally more player-friendly.
  • Game contributions vary—slots usually count 100%, but table games might only count 10%.
  • Watch the expiry date; most bonuses must be cleared within 7–30 days.
  • Never plan to lose money just to meet a bonus; treat it as a perk, not a promise.

Understanding Return-to-Player Percentages for Smarter Bets

Understanding Return-to-Player Percentages for Smarter Bets directly protects your bankroll. An RTP of 96% means you statistically regain $96 for every $100 wagered long-term, making games with higher RTPs your priority. Before any real-money spin, check the game’s paytable; a 98% slot versus a 94% slot represents a 4% gap in theoretical return. Avoid low-RTP side bets like certain table-game bonuses that can drain funds faster. Use RTP data to choose slots or video poker that align with your playtime goals—higher RTP stretches your bankroll for more rounds. How Long Do Withdrawals Typically Take?

Withdrawal times at a real-money casino depend entirely on your chosen method. E-wallet withdrawals are usually the quickest, often arriving within 24 hours. Debit cards and bank transfers typically take 2–5 business days, while cryptocurrency payouts can process in under an hour. Most casinos also add a pending period of 24–72 hours to review your request for security. Here’s the typical sequence:

  1. You submit the withdrawal in your account.
  2. The casino processes it (pending period).
  3. Funds leave the casino and travel to your payment provider.
  4. Your provider posts the money to your account.

Always check the casino’s banking page for exact timing on each method.

Can I Practice Games Before Betting Actual Money?

Yes, most real-money casinos let you practice games before betting actual money. They offer free demo or play-for-fun modes for slots, table games, and sometimes video poker. These demos use virtual credits, letting you learn rules, test strategies, and observe payout frequencies without financial risk. The game mechanics, paytables, and volatility mirror the real-money versions, though progressive jackpots are typically excluded. Once comfortable, you can switch to real stakes at the same table. Always check for a “demo” or “practice” toggle on the game lobby before depositing.
